What is the difference between Tenison Park and Tenison Glen?

Tenison Highlands is a remodeled upscale course over tree-lined fairways and picturesque elevation changes, while Tenison Glen is a classic course and a favorite of Dallas golfers since 1924. Access to either course also allows access to a state-of-the-art practice and teaching facility, a fully stocked golf shop and the courses’ shared café. Tenison Highlands greens fees start at $22; Tenison Glen greens fees start at $12.

What is the best golf course in Dallas?

A ccording to The Culture Trip, The best golf course in Dallas is Cedar Crest Golf Course. The 18-hole golf course was originally designed by A. W. Tillinghast in 1919. The course has hosted the Dallas Open in both 1926 and the PGA Championship in 1927. Therefore, it is significant to the history of golf in Texas.

What golf course is in Tenison Park?

Tenison Park Golf Course. There are two golf courses at this venue; the Tenison Highlands Course and the Tension Glen course. The claim to fame of the Tenison Glen course is that it was the first municipally-owned golf course in Dallas as it was constructed on land donated by the Tenison family in 1924.

Where is the tribute golf course?

The Tribute is located just off the eastern shores of Lake Lewisville, in The Colony . The course offers a Scottish links-style golf experience with a touch of southern hospitality. The Tribute features all the qualities of a true links course, such as wind-swept dunes, deep bunkers, and sea-washed grasses.

Is Cowboys Golf Club open?

Cowboys Golf Club in Grapevine is the first and only NFL-themed golf club in the world. It is open to the public and features a beautiful clubhouse, a golf practice facility, a world-class golf shop, banquet and meeting rooms, and (of course) the spectacular championship golf course with stone markers highlighting Dallas Cowboys history. Whether you're a Cowboys fan or not, you'll love golfing on this course.

Who won the 1927 PGA Championship?

Home of the 1927 PGA Championship, the story goes that golfer Walter Hagen was near elimination when a young spectator, 15-year-old Byron Nelson, handed him a cap to shield the sun from his eyes, allowing Hagen to take the lead and eventually win the championship. 1800 Southerland Ave., Dallas; 214.670.7615.
